    What once was known as a simple ghost story in the town of Ravens Fair, the tale of the ventriloquist Mary Shaw is brought to life in this frightening film where those who see her should never scream or else she'll take their tongue.

    Unwind by Neal Shusterman depicts a disturbing reality where unwanted children are legally captured and taken to harvest camps to be "unwound". This book reveals a journey between three runaway teenagers as they struggle to fight the unwinding system and discover what it truly means to be alive.
